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ions
Sitevision versions 10.3.1 and earlier
Description
A security issue in Sitevision allows a remote attacker, in certain non-default scenarios, to gain access to the private keys used for signing SAML authentication requests. The underlying issue is a Java keystore that may become accessible and downloadable via WebDAV. This keystore is protected with a low-complexity, auto-generated password.
Recommendations
For Sitevision versions 10.3.1 and earlier, consider disabling WebDAV access to the Java keystore as a temporary workaround until a patch is available. Restrict access to the keystore to minimize the risk of exploitation. Avoid using auto-generated passwords for the keystore. At the moment, there is no information about a newer version that contains a fix for this vulnerability.
